Grateful Dead, Hells Angels 1970 Anderson Theater, New York Concert Poster. An original, large, pre-show-printing concert poster for the Grateful Dead playing at the Anderson Theatre in the Greenwich Village section of New York City on Monday night, November 23, 1970. The Hells Angels motorcycle club "presented" the show because it was a benefit concert for their New York chapter.

The Anderson was located at 66 2nd Avenue in Greenwich Village. To help promote the show and sell tickets, these large posters with terrific Grateful Dead/motorcycle graphics - notice the whole poster is shaped like a tombstone - were printed and distributed around town. Imagine, it only cost a donation of $2.00 to see the Dead in the same month they released their classic album American Beauty, containing evergreens like "Box of Rain," "Friend of the Devil," "Sugar Magnolia" and, yes, "Truckin'."
